Type
ORACLE
Validation date
2024-01-12 19:54:30 UTC
Fee
0 UCO

Code (249 B)

condition inherit: [
  # We need to ensure the type stays consistent
  # So we can apply specific rules during the transaction validation
  type: in?([oracle, oracle_summary]),

  # We discard the content and code verification
  content: true,

  # We ensure the code stay the same
  code: if type == oracle_summary do
    regex_match?("condition inherit: \\[[\\s].*content: \\\"\\\"[\\s].*]")
  else
    previous.code
  end
]

Content (36 B)

{
  "uco": {
    "eur": 0.04482,
    "usd": 0.0491
  }
}

State (0 B)

Movements (0)

Ownerships (0)

Contract recipients (0)

Inputs (0)

Contract inputs (0)

Unspent outputs (1)

Proofs and signatures

Previous public key

0001AE631E44D57EAC66E84A6FA8762C418B9CBFA91F368D11AE6FBC5AAD7510DCFE

Previous signature

0CC60719135D44033E1753475A79A36FB3217BEA8F4B175D59CD2A9C80807BC67F579ED86FA6A2A0B11823562597D1A21C1156FBAD7E830C937D57200394D109

Origin signature

3046022100F576099AF72A48B3171F7C97FC5C5639CB150B70A1B6D78D69467EC28D4E5CDC0221008EB5E6A18A5B543E5876D91E8496199521795F382089610A4452049ED5EC6A82

Proof of work

01010484B78F4110D8E9D6FBEC72759895CC9D4532177314FBAA8B07BC525FC1AF48F150EFBF104B1819106B8E3563CD0E1FAAE5325F8FCFE58FF744C35F47669D2704

Proof of integrity

00910101C018A1548801CFF67052DFD7C708F7E19E1F626CFC838F7CEEFDF5B2FF

Coordinator signature

C65443CF6E22678D7E355D3043C7213495ED4D9E4BB0A5B44FBAB72F0B8D9B4A3E7359BB006AE111586288381D43144CA4DE9658669851BB4F474471F5F92804

Validator #1 public key

00010F2A0E4C424582A94BD90E05FE6931628F91988ABBE387D365994F1F3FCF5A12

Validator #1 signature

3408594D84B5540CEF1B99F53674067A94213F1088E9DA1EF08C2B6C43F7DF046B4ADA3A67902DE3A80029BD1F3AB34ACE40C288820BF90DE5F0A0B97758E90C

Validator #2 public key

0001500FBE298B79FFBDD5CCA1798F30FD88A53D26EC39DE5DDE1F4137B032A4BC34

Validator #2 signature

408688C80361A6E0D0CAA1CAC5E52CA5A1872E9ABDEA1BA84DC36E5DFA3F80CF1016E4F06F67EB3533B24E25DF874BDFF03D24FFC86CC10A638C98471A6BAC0D